Fresno in spanish signifies ash tree and it was due to the abundance of mountain ash or ash trees in the county that it received its name. Typical reasons for parcel and apn changes include combination with other parcels, division into smaller parcels, surveys, or renumbering parcels to alleviate overcrowding on a map page or map book. As of the 2010 census, the city s population was 510,365, making it the fifth largest city in california, the largest inland city in california, and the 34th largest in the nation. Fresno county comprises the fresno, ca metropolitan statistical area, which is part of the fresno madera, ca combined statistical area.
